CHARGE OF PERJURY.
the ■waihi-case; (By,Telecraph-Pro!s-Ac£ociation.) ■.' JYaihl, January '21.' . At the'-Magistrate's Court this afternoon,- Walter Edmund Harvey, on remand, was charged,, on the. information of Detcctivp' Sweeney, with committing; perjury, at tho inquest touching the, death of 'Frederick "Goorgo Evans, held on December 13 at Waihi, in that he swore on oath: (1) That ho never carried a revolver in New JCealand; (2) that lie did not present a. revolver at. ono. of six persons at Karangahnko on November 10j and, (3) that ho did • liot- say on that occasion, "All right, Bill;-I'vp got you covert," or any words to that effect, Mr. Jackson represented the accused. -•'•'.-.
Sergeant Wbhlniann' briefly stated . the circumstances of the case, and said that the charge was. laid, under Section 130 of the Crimes-Act. •.'•.;:. .':.,.. ■ , ■.■■.
' The first witness-was tho District Coroner, Mr. IV. M. Wnllnutt. He saidtlxit Harvey had given sworn evidence in keeping with.the indictment after being warned by Mr. J; R; Lnndon, counsel for relatives of the deceased, of • the penaliles which.might.bo incurred by persons com T milting perjury. -~■ •■ ~-. - : -.. ■, ■:■.::■. ■ Several witnesses supported the statement as set-fprth/,ip.tho indictment, Accused Was 'committed to stand .his" trial-' at the-next sitting' of the-Supremo Court at Auckland,: bail..being allowed on his personal recognisance of XIOO, and two sureties ,of..' £i\>. each,..- • .
